After debuting earlier this week around <\/span><b>$0.32<\/b><span>, the token slid to below <\/span><b>$0.18<\/b><span>, losing more than <\/span><b>40% of its value in days<\/b><span>.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span>The decline sparked speculation that Sun had triggered a sell-off by moving a large batch of tokens. Onchain trackers Nansen and Arkham confirmed his address transferred <\/span><b>50 million WLFI tokens worth $9 million<\/b><span> to HTX exchange.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3>On-Chain Analysis Clears Sun<\/h3>\n<p><span>Blockchain analytics suggest Sun was not behind the sharp fall. According to Nansen, the crash started hours earlier when BitGo released nearly <\/span><b>41 million WLFI tokens<\/b><span> to Flowdesk, a market maker. Flowdesk rapidly distributed them across Bybit, OKX, and Binance, flooding supply and pushing prices down more than <\/span><b>11% within hours<\/b><span>.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span>Sun\u2019s $9M transfer happened later, well after the price drop. Nansen\u2019s CEO, Alex Svanevik, even posted evidence showing Sun\u2019s transaction could not have caused the sell-off. Sun quickly amplified the findings, posting simply: <\/span><i><span>\u201cI am innocent.\u201d<\/span><\/i><\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/www.cryptoninjas.net\/wp-content\/uploads\/justin-sun-tron.jpg\" alt=\"justin-sun-tron\" width=\"1600\" height=\"900\"><\/p>\n<h3>Governance Concerns at WLFI<\/h3>\n<p><span>The freeze of Sun\u2019s tokens adds another layer of uncertainty.
